FROM THE ARCHIVES

40 years ago

January 11, 1978

Werribee Shire Council has commenced roadworks which are necessary for installation of signals at the intersection of Watton Street/Duncans Road/Station Street. The major feature of these roadworks involves the closure of the western entrance into Station Street adjoining the Werribee Hotel.

30 years ago

January 13, 1988

The Federal and State Governments and the Werribee Council will spend $905,000 in an effort to stop the Werribee River from flooding every three or four years. The Minister for Water Resources Mr Wilkes announced on Thursday that the flood plan was submitted by the State Rural Water Commission to the Federal Government’s Water Resources Assistance Program and grants were approved.

10 years ago

January 16, 2008

Wyndham Mayor Kim McAliney last week joined the growing chorus of residents and community groups calling on the State Government to invest in the Werribee technology precinct. As reported in the

Banner last May, the Committee for Werribee, an influential group of business and community leaders, urged the Government to establish an independent authority to lead development of the precinct.
